India Defeat Korea 5-0, Move to Women's Asian Championship Semis

By: WE Staff | Friday, 3 November 2023

Team India secured a 5-0 win against Korea in its final league match, maintaining its unbeaten streak at the Jharkhand Women's Asian Champions Trophy Ranchi 2023, paving the way for a semi-final rematch.

The knockout games fixed for Saturday will follow the same Thursday's fixtures, featuring China and Japan in the other semifinal and Malaysia and Thailand battling for the fifth spot.

Team Korea had previously grabbed the silver medal at the Asian Games but this time Team India, a top-ranked team, surprised Korea with its aggressive and attacking play, thrashing them on the field.

Team India played unstoppable and relentlessly with intense moves that defeated Korea to regain possession. The pace of the game was entirely controlled by India.

India scored a goal through Salima Tete and Sangita Kumari, securing a 3-0 lead. India continued to dominate the match, scoring twice within a minute to go up 3-0, with Salima and Sangita combining and Navneet Kaur's powerful hit. The finishing touches were given by Vandana Katariya and Neha Goyal.
